I plan to carry out maintenance on my catalytic unit after the Spring Festival, and my superiors require that the stabilization system be maintained without withdrawing oil or performing purging and replacement operations. The maintenance work includes replacing the tube bundles of two of the four water-cooled compressed rich gas coolers, as well as the inlet and outlet gate valves of the feed pumps in the two desorption towers. Those whose catalytic downtime is a bit longer – does everyone know what this means? The moment the blind flange is installed is also when air enters; once the air mixes with oil and gas, what happens when it comes into contact with the deposited iron sulfide? Steam purging should be carried out at the areas that need maintenance; Those of you in charge of safety should be able to coordinate well with the workshop.
The entry of a small amount of air is not a major problem. The feed pump for the distillation column has control valves and heat exchangers at its outlet; by closing several of these valves and installing blind flanges near them, it’s fine even if a small amount of air gets in. The heat exchanger tubes that need to be replaced should be purged after the inlet and outlet valves are closed, followed by the installation of blind flanges before proceeding with further operations. This process requires coordination among the workshop’s process engineers, safety officers, and equipment specialists to develop an appropriate plan before implementation

During maintenance, normal purging and displacement procedures can still lead to spontaneous combustion of iron sulfide when the compressed rich gas cooler is disassembled. Moreover, this time we can only use temporary steam and water pipes for purging and displacement, which makes the task more difficult and increases the risk; if anything goes wrong, it could mean my job is at stake.
